Summary

As introduced Bill 25-224 would provide statutory rules for a trustee’s distribution of assets from one irrevocable trust to another. It provides appropriate limits on a trustee’s ability to decant to ensure that the settlor’s intent is carried out. It would protect beneficiaries by requiring notice and protecting all vested interests. It would provide that charitable interests may not be reduced or eliminated and also would protect successor trustees from liability.
